Output 4baff33e6d4041a7ee917803aeaf4d7a9ea20f2199459e154a833cee249fd586:2

value
1523414959
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b45a0e78faafce5bf4b0c1dd2898ba64b920d490 OP_EQUALVERIFY OP_CHECKSIG
address
1HScWmVbFHcV36jxwTF3mU2uukhyUC9XY8
transaction
4baff33e6d4041a7ee917803aeaf4d7a9ea20f2199459e154a833cee249fd586